Early Life and Family Roots
Zeke Thurston was born on November 15, 1994, in Big Valley, Alberta, Canada. Rodeo runs deep in Zeke’s veins, with his family being an integral part of this tradition. His father, Skeeter Thurston, was a six-time National Finals Rodeo (NFR) qualifier in saddle bronc riding, setting an example of grit and determination for Zeke and his siblings. His mother, Lynda, is a journalist and singer, while his sister, Tess, competes in barrel racing and goat tying, further enriching the family’s western sports legacy.
Growing up in Alberta, Zeke, alongside his brothers Sam and Wyatt, was steeped in the culture of rodeo from a young age. Their family showcased trick riding and roping as “The Thurston Gang” and even performed for Prince William and Princess Kate.
Education and Early Exposure in Rodeo
Zeke’s education often revolved around supporting his ambitions in rodeo. He focused on balancing his studies with his budding career in the sport, participating in both junior and high school rodeo competitions.
Zeke’s exceptional talent emerged early as he earned accolades in steer riding and went on to qualify for the National High School Finals Rodeo three times. Later, he competed in the College National Finals Rodeo (CNFR), further honing his skills in saddle bronc riding.
Career Highlights and Achievements
Joining the Pro Circuit
Zeke joined the Professional Rodeo Cowboys Association (PRCA) in 2015, and his ascent was meteoric. By 2016, in just his second year on the pro circuit, Zeke claimed his first PRCA World Title. That year, he also earned the Wrangler NFR Aggregate title, proving his exceptional versatility and consistency.
Zeke further cemented his legacy with a second PRCA World Title in 2019. Riding Special Delivery, a famed bucking horse from the Calgary Stampede, Zeke scored an impressive 94 points — one point shy of the world record.
Notable Achievements
During his career, Zeke has achieved the following milestones:
- Two PRCA World Titles (2016, 2019)
- Five NFR Qualifications
- One Wrangler NFR Aggregate Title
- One Canadian Saddle Bronc Title
